    George RR Martin's told the show producers all the major plots that he's planning on writing in the books, both for when the show over takes the books, and in the event he may not live to write all the books. Given the way the show is starting to change from the books (simplifying storylines and removing some characters) this should be sufficient to continue to produce the show.
